Önceki makalede, gelişmiş hata raporlamasından (Gelişmiş Hata Raporlaması, AER) bahsedilmiş ve ardından bu özelliği ayrıntılı olarak tanıtılmıştır. Mevcut PCIe hata raporlama mekanizmasında (önceki makalede açıklanan), AER aşağıdaki özellikleri de destekler:
· Gerçekte meydana gelen hata türlerini kaydederken, daha iyi bir ayrıntı söz konusudur (Ayrımcılık veya doğruluk olarak anlaşılabilecek taneciklik)
· Çeşitli düzeltilemez hataların ciddiyetini ayırt edin
· Başlıktaki hataları kaydetme desteği
· Kesinti raporlaması yoluyla Root tarafından alınan hata mesajları için standartlaştırılmış bir kontrol mekanizması sağlar
· PCIe mimarisindeki hata kaynağının konumu bulunabilir
· Belirli (veya birden çok) hata türünün raporlarını bağımsız olarak koruma yeteneği
Konfigürasyon alanındaki AER ile ilgili kayıt yapısı aşağıdaki şekilde gösterilmektedir:
Önceki makalede birçok kez bahsedildiği gibi, ECRC kalibrasyon tarafından üretilir ve AER desteğine ihtiyaç duyar ve ilgili kontrol biti, aşağıdaki şekilde gösterildiği gibi gelişmiş hata fonksiyonu kontrol kaydında bulunur:
Bunlar arasında en düşük 5 bit, ilgili hata durumu güncellendiğinde donanım tarafından otomatik olarak güncellenen mevcut hata göstericisidir (İlk Hata İşaretçisi). Genel olarak, mevcut hata işaretçisinin işaret ettiği hata, en yüksek önceliğe sahip olan, ilk önce ele alınması gereken ve genellikle diğer hataların kaynağı olan hatadır. PCIe Spec V2.1 ayrıca Birden Fazla Hatanın İzlenmesini de destekler.
Şekildeki ROS, RWS, RO ve diğer karakterlerin anlamları aşağıdaki gibidir:
· RO Salt Okunur, donanım tarafından kontrol edilir
· ROS-Salt Okunur ve Yapışkan
· RsvdP'ye özeldir ve başka amaçlar için kullanılamaz
· RsvdZ-saklıdır ve yalnızca 0 olarak yazılabilir
· RWS Okunabilir, Yazılabilir ve Yapışkan (Okunabilir, Yazılabilir ve Yapışkan)
· RW1CS Okunabilir, 1 yazarak temizlenir ve sıfırlanamaz
Sıfırlanmama, bit içeriğinin sıfırlama nedeniyle değişmeyeceği anlamına gelir (güç kapatıldıktan sonra açılış sıfırlaması hariç). PCIe veriyolunda birçok sıfırlama konsepti vardır.Kapışkan bitler (sıfırlanmayan bitler), İşlev Seviyesi Sıfırlama (FLR), Hızlı Sıfırlama ve Sıcak Sıfırlamadan etkilenmez veya Soğuk Sıfırlamadan etkilenir (ana güç kaynağı kesildiğinde, Vaux gibi ikincil güç kaynağı hala normal güç kaynağını korur). PCIe veriyolunun sıfırlama mekanizması ile ilgili olarak, bir takip makalesi onu ayrıntılı olarak tanıtacaktır.